What Is Product Finder for WooCommerce?

Product Finder Plugin is a premium WooCommerce plugin that allows you to create interactive product recommendation forms. Customers answer a series of questions (based on attributes, preferences, or use cases), and the plugin automatically suggests the most relevant products.

It’s like building a mini quiz or assistant that leads each visitor to their perfect product.

1. Multi-Step Questionnaire Builder

The plugin allows you to create a step-by-step product quiz using various question types, such as:

  • Dropdowns

  • Checkboxes (multiple answers)

  • Radio buttons (single choice)

  • Range sliders (e.g., price or intensity)

  • Yes/No questions

  • Conditional logic (show/hide steps based on previous answers)

Use Case: A skincare brand builds a quiz with steps like:

  1. What’s your skin type?

  2. What’s your main skin concern?

  3. Do you prefer fragrance-free products?

At the end, only the most relevant serums or moisturizers are displayed.

2. Attribute-Based Product Matching

You can connect quiz responses directly to WooCommerce product attributes, tags, categories, or specific product IDs. This lets you control:

  • Which products show based on answers

  • How answers filter product results

  • Whether to show exact or close matches

Use Case: An electronics store connects “screen size” and “price range” answers to laptops with matching attributes.

3. Smart Filtering and Results Display

After the quiz, customers see a personalized product listing page filtered according to their answers. The results can be:

  • Grid or list view

  • Ordered by relevance or popularity

  • Linked to direct product pages

  • Limited to top results or paginated

Use Case: A supplement brand shows 3 “recommended vitamins” based on user health goals and dietary restrictions.

8. Conditional Logic and Branching

Advanced forms can use conditional logic:

  • Show or hide questions based on previous answers

  • Skip irrelevant steps

  • Offer different result pages based on quiz paths

Use Case: A fitness store asks if a user is pregnant, and if yes, shows prenatal-safe product questions.

How to Set It Up

Here’s how to get started:

  1. Purchase and install the plugin

  2. Go to WooCommerce → Product Finder in your dashboard

  3. Click Create New Finder

  4. Add steps using dropdowns, checkboxes, radio buttons, or sliders

  5. Assign logic to connect responses with product categories or attributes

  6. Customize the design: progress bar, step labels, button text

  7. Save and copy the shortcode

  8. Paste the shortcode into any page, blog post, or builder section

  9. Test the quiz for usability and results accuracy

  10. (Optional) Track analytics and tweak based on conversion performance

In less than an hour, you can have a complete product recommendation quiz live on your store.
